Sun StorEdge D2 12 Drive Disk Array 595-6216
Sun StorEdge D2 12 Drive Disk Array 595-6216
Regular price
$390.55
Regular price
$459.47
Sale price
$390.55
Unit price
/
per
Sun StorEdge D2 12 Drive Disk Array